It’s been three months since the Knysna fires gutted 600 homes, displaced more than 10 000 people and tallied insured damages in excess of R4billion. The aftermath has delivered some very hard lessons in managing risk, not least of which are the importance of professional, qualified advice and the need to review and update insurance covers at least once a year, or more frequently if there is a material change to your insured risks.
